Freely streaming service expands live channels to over 40 in major upgrade
Freely, a new streaming service, has upgraded its offerings by increasing the number of live channels from 20 to over 40. New channels include AMC Networks International UK, PBS America, GB News, and QVC, enhancing its content variety. Freely is now built into TVs from brands like Toshiba and Panasonic, providing a free alternative to Sky Glass. It features a TV guide and the ability to pause live TV, but lacks some advanced features of Sky Glass, such as personalized recommendations. Sky Glass remains the more comprehensive option, with over 100 channels and better integration with other streaming services. However, Freely's recent improvements make it a more competitive choice for viewers seeking free content.
